Create Strong Passwords

Your password is your first line of defense against unauthorized access. A strong password should be a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ters, ideally exceeding 12 characters. Avoid using easily guessable details such as birthdays or common words.

Consider using a password manager to help you generate and store complex passwords securely. Regularly updating your password is also crucial in maintaining your account’s safety.

Enable Two-Factor Authentication

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an additional layer of security to your casino account. With 2FA enabled, you will need to provide a second piece of information, typically a code sent to your mobile device or email, when logging in.

This extra step significantly reduces the likelihood of unauthorized access, as even if someone obtains your password, they would still need the second authentication factor. Check if your preferred online casino offers this feature and activate it as soon as possible.

Monitor Your Account Activity

Regularly reviewing your account activity is a proactive approach to identifying any unusual behavior. Most reputable online casinos provide transaction history that allows players to monitor their bets, deposits, and withdrawals.

If you notice any discrepancies, report them to the casino’s customer support immediately. Additionally, keeping an eye on your email for security notifications from the casino can help you catch potential threats early.

Stay Informed About Security Policies

Before choosing an online casino, familiarize yourself with its security policies. Legitimate casinos will often have detailed information regarding their encryption methods, privacy policies, and data protection measures.

Understanding how your chosen casino safeguards your personal and financial information can provide peace of mind while you enjoy your gaming experience.

Use Secure Internet Connections

Your internet connection plays a vital role in your online security. Always use a secure and private connection, preferably your home Wi-Fi, when accessing your casino account. Avoid public Wi-Fi networks, as they can be breeding grounds for cyber threats.

If you must use a public network, consider utilizing a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to encrypt your internet traffic, further protecting your data from prying eyes.
